外文摘要:As a highly successful mariculture candidate endemic to China, the wild genetic resource of large yellow croaker (Larimichthys crocea) have collapsed in the northern and central East China Seas, which has impeded the wild sampling and assessment. Meanwhile, the wild population in South China Sea away from restocking and massive aquaculture is seldom reported. In this study, the complete mitochondrial control regions (CR) of 98 individuals of Naozhou stock were determined and the data indicated that the haplotype diversity of Naozhou stock (H-d > 98%) is higher than all the reported values. Inconsistent with previous conclusion by traditional methods, the non-significant S-nn and F-ST owing to the strong gene flows (N-m), as well as the cluster tree without substructure reflected the lack of population differentiation in Large yellow croaker of Naozhou stock. Moreover, the demographic history was examined by using neutrality tests and mismatch distribution analysis, which revealed that the species obey the sudden expansion model. This result should be basic file for fisheries management and assessment of croaker. (C) 2014 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
